Lately, "inexperienced" claims are just about everywhere, from cleaning materials to sheets, rendering it challenging for shoppers to recognize which products are certainly sustainable. You'll want to generally be looking out for "greenwashing," which can be when an organization deceptively places eco-helpful statements around the packaging in their products without any distinct evidence or tests to back again up their assertions.

By natural means sourced comforters (aka duvets) often have cotton shells and down fill. Down arises from the exceedingly tender and lightweight undercoats of geese and ducks. It is really deemed a sustainable product as it grows again in as tiny as 6 weeks.
